What is ordercup?

Ordercup is a shipping management tool designed to streamline the shipping process for e-commerce businesses. Its primary purpose is to help users manage orders, print shipping labels, and track shipments efficiently.

What is shipsurance?

Shipsurance is a service that provides shipping insurance for packages sent through various carriers. Its primary purpose is to protect sellers and shippers from financial loss due to lost or damaged shipments.

Frequently Asked Questions

What types of businesses benefit from ordercup?

E-commerce businesses that require efficient shipping management and integration with sales platforms can benefit from Ordercup.

How does shipsurance handle claims?

Shipsurance allows users to submit claims online, providing a streamlined process for recovering losses from lost or damaged shipments.

Can I use ordercup without a subscription?

No, Ordercup operates on a subscription-based model, requiring users to pay for access to its services.

Is shipsurance available for all carriers?

Shipsurance typically covers a range of major carriers, but it is advisable to check specific carrier eligibility on their website.
